2. Improve Airflow and Ventilation

Proper airflow and ventilation are essential for managing condensation on patio doors. I've found that one of the most effective ways to address this is by installing strategically placed fans or vents near the doors. This helps to circulate the air and prevent stagnant, moist air from building up around the doors.

4. Seal and Weatherstrip Patio Doors

Ensuring a tight seal around your patio doors is crucial for preventing condensation. I've found that properly sealing and weatherstripping the doors can make a significant difference in reducing moisture buildup. By addressing any gaps or cracks, you can create a barrier that keeps warm, moist air from escaping and causing condensation on the cooler surfaces.

5. Optimize Glass Coatings and Treatments

The type of glass and any coatings or treatments applied to it can also play a significant role in reducing condensation on patio doors. I've had excellent success with specialized low-emissivity (low-E) glass coatings that support to maintain a more consistent temperature across the door's surface. These coatings can prevent heat loss and minimize the temperature difference that leads to condensation buildup.
